Output 34cacab549c5b7e51795173c3ebd468a6db2ab2673a71e7f1a8d3b06b7effd68:1

value
145603879
script pubkey
OP_0 OP_PUSHBYTES_20 167cf2c5636ee0018f377b5490340d4c84be86ec
address
tb1qze7093trdmsqrreh0d2fqdqdfjztaphvvgtcaa
transaction
34cacab549c5b7e51795173c3ebd468a6db2ab2673a71e7f1a8d3b06b7effd68